They often treat it as a help desk annoyance or a desktop policy, when it is really a governance decision about who can create risk on the device. If privilege exceptions are left open-ended, the control becomes cosmetic and entitlement creep returns in another form.

Why Security Teams Misread Endpoint Least Privilege

Endpoint least privilege fails when it is treated as a convenience setting instead of a control over who can create risk on a device. The real issue is not whether a user can install software one more time; it is whether the endpoint becomes a standing escalation path for malware, credential theft, or unauthorized tooling. That is why NHI Management Group treats endpoint privilege as governance, not just desktop hygiene.

The pattern is visible in broader identity research. NHI Management Group’s Ultimate Guide to NHIs shows how excessive privileges and weak rotation create durable exposure, and the same logic applies on endpoints: if privilege is broad, persistent, or hard to review, it becomes an attack surface rather than a safeguard. The OWASP Non-Human Identity Top 10 also reinforces that standing access and weak entitlement discipline are recurring failure modes, even when teams believe they have “restricted” access.

The practical mistake is assuming that endpoint privilege only matters for admins. In reality, local elevation can let attackers disable protections, harvest secrets, and pivot into cloud or SaaS systems already trusted by the device. In practice, many security teams encounter privilege sprawl only after a help desk exception, software deployment, or incident response action has already become a permanent bypass.

How Endpoint Least Privilege Should Work in Practice

Effective endpoint least privilege starts with defining the task, not the person. Access should be scoped to the action needed on the device, then removed when the task ends. That means replacing open-ended admin rights with tightly bounded elevation, short approval windows, and strong logging. The principle aligns with NIST SP 800-207 Zero Trust Architecture, which assumes trust must be continuously evaluated rather than granted once and forgotten.

In mature environments, endpoint privilege is usually implemented as a blend of controls rather than a single tool:

  • Standard users operate without standing local admin rights.
  • Elevated actions require time-bound approval or policy-based automation.
  • Software installation is limited to managed paths and approved packages.
  • Privileged sessions are recorded, reviewed, and revoked quickly.
  • Secrets and tokens are kept out of the endpoint wherever possible.

This becomes even more important when endpoints are used to access cloud consoles, development pipelines, or AI tooling, because a compromised device can become a launch point for broader identity abuse. The same risk pattern appears in NHIMG’s Microsoft SAS Key Breach, where a single exposed credential can translate into far wider operational impact than the local event suggests. The control works best when privilege is revocable, exceptions are rare, and device state is part of the authorization decision. These controls tend to break down in BYOD-heavy environments where the organisation cannot reliably manage software state, patching, or local policy enforcement.

Where Teams Get Tripped Up on Exceptions and Operating Reality

Tighter endpoint control often increases friction, requiring organisations to balance user productivity against the risk of permanent exception creep. That tradeoff is real, and current guidance suggests the answer is not to eliminate exceptions but to make them explicit, short-lived, and reviewable.

Teams commonly get stuck in three places. First, they confuse temporary elevation with permanent trust, especially when a help desk ticket becomes a standing allowance. Second, they overestimate the safety of “trusted” power users and fail to notice that developers, analysts, and admins often have the most attractive endpoints to attackers. Third, they rely on policy language without operational proof, so no one can answer who had elevated access, why they had it, and whether it was still needed.

There is no universal standard for endpoint least privilege maturity, but best practice is evolving toward continuous verification, exception expiry, and stronger device governance. The key question is not whether a workstation is managed in theory, but whether local privilege can be created, used, and removed without leaving durable residual access behind. In real environments, this usually breaks down where identity, endpoint management, and support workflows are owned by different teams and no one is accountable for closing the loop.
